Successive Approximations
A method used in behavioral psychology involving the reinforcement of behaviors that are increasingly similar to the desired behavior.
Reinforcements
In psychology, reinforcements refer to incentives or consequences that strengthen the behavior they follow, making it more likely to occur in the future.
Chaining
A behavioral technique of teaching complex tasks by breaking them down into simpler steps or components.
